Sotheby's to Auction $8 Million Collection of Rare Jewels
Sotheby's New York will auction a private collection of jewels, including rare pieces from Suzanne Belperron and JAR, totaling an estimated value exceeding $8 million, marking the opening of their new headquarters and first evening jewelry auction in over a decade.

Chalençon Auctions Extensive Napoleon Collection at Sotheby's
Pierre-Jean Chalençon, the world's foremost collector of Napoleon Bonaparte memorabilia, is auctioning more than 100 items from his collection at Sotheby's Paris on June 24th, including Napoleon's iconic bicorne hat, estimated at €500,000-€800,000.

India Seeks to Halt Auction of Sacred Buddhist Gems
India's Ministry of Culture issued a legal notice to stop the upcoming Hong Kong auction of ancient Piprahwa gems, dating back to 240-200 BC, which it considers sacred relics and whose sale violates international law, demanding their repatriation.

Sotheby's to Auction Collection of Brazilian Activist Niomar Moniz Sodré Bittencourt
Sotheby's Paris auction on April 10th will sell the collection of Brazilian journalist and activist Niomar Moniz Sodré Bittencourt, including works by Picasso, Giacometti, and Max Ernst, with expected proceeds between 7 and 10.7 million Euros.

Sotheby's Saudi Auction: $17M in Sales, Regional Art Outperforms Luxury
Sotheby's inaugural auction in Saudi Arabia, held in Diriyah on Saturday, totaled $17.28 million with a 67% sell-through rate by lot and 74% by value, exceeding expectations by showcasing strong demand for regional art, especially works by Saudi and Arab artists.

Rediscovered Turner Painting to Auction for €350,000
A painting initially valued at under €1000, later identified as a 1792 JMW Turner work titled "The Rising Squall," will be auctioned at Sotheby's in London on July 2nd for an expected €350,000, highlighting the impact of art restoration on valuation.

Sotheby's UFO-Themed Watch Auction Nets $1.6 Million
Sotheby's Geneva 'Area_51' auction, a UFO-themed watch sale held April 3rd, saw a F.P. Journe watch sell for $238,425, contributing to a total of $1.6 million in sales with nearly a third of buyers under 40.
